The local history of Horní Ředice includes the present-day Church of St. Wenceslas: it was consecrated on September 28, 1863, and served both Horní Ředice and Dolní Ředice. Both municipalities contributed equally to its construction.
Culture and History
Together with the wooden bell tower, the church dominates the surrounding area. The cemetery by the church includes a wooden bell tower with three bells; the largest dates from 1616. Remains of the former fortification of the churchyard are visible on the west side.
The chapel in Horní Ředice also bears witness to the history of the village. It dates from 1836 and was reconstructed in 2003 by the Lubomír Váša restoration studio. The Ředice archaeological burial site contains finds dating to the Bronze Age.
Nature and Landscape
Hořaník, the eastern peak of the Hořánka hill, is 265 m high and offers views of the Loučná valley and as far as the Železné hory mountains. A field path leads from the Church of St. Wenceslas via Farský kopec to the Hořánka hill.
The Žernov Nature Reserve lies north of Horní Ředice in the nearby area. It includes ponds, reed beds, and wet meadows.
Sports and Leisure
Horní Ředice has two clay tennis courts, where tennis tournaments and a summer tennis school are regularly held. The reconstructed minigolf course near the community hall has 13 holes and is located by a stream with seating areas.
The multi-purpose sports field by the primary school can be used for floorball, nohejbal, tennis, volleyball, and many other ball sports. In the Blanka area, there is a 180 m long running track and a 60 m long straight track with a long-jump facility. At the embankment of Ředický rybník, there are two exercise machines and seating for walkers.
